What is Ubuntu?

The open-source ecosystem offers enhanced security features, a broader selection of packages, and state-of-the-art tools, covering environments from cloud to edge. To protect your open-source applications, it is vital to maintain thorough patching practices that span from the kernel through libraries and applications, ensuring compliance with CVEs. Both governmental bodies and auditors have confirmed Ubuntu's compliance with essential standards such as FedRAMP, FISMA, and HITECH. Now is the perfect moment to rethink the possibilities that Linux and open-source technologies can provide. Many organizations collaborate with Canonical to lower the expenses tied to open-source operating systems. By automating various processes, including multi-cloud management, bare metal provisioning, edge clusters, and IoT devices, you can achieve greater efficiency. Ubuntu stands out as an ideal platform for diverse professionals, ranging from mobile app developers and engineering managers to video editors and financial analysts handling intricate models. Its adaptability, reliability, ongoing updates, and extensive libraries make it a preferred choice for development teams worldwide. With a strong community backing and a dedication to ongoing innovation, Ubuntu continues to be a top contender in the realm of open-source solutions, making it an attractive option for both new and experienced users. Additionally, its versatility and user-friendly interface facilitate a smooth transition for those new to open-source software.

What is Alpine Linux?

Alpine Linux is a distinctive, non-commercial general-purpose distribution designed for advanced users who emphasize security, simplicity, and efficient use of resources. Constructed with musl libc and busybox, it achieves a compact size and improved performance when compared to traditional GNU/Linux distributions. A container can function using as little as 8 MB of memory, while a minimal installation on disk requires approximately 130 MB of storage. Users enjoy not only a full Linux environment but also access to a broad range of packages in its repository. The binary packages are optimized and modular, allowing for enhanced customization during installations, thus ensuring the system remains lightweight and efficient. Alpine Linux takes pride in its straightforward nature, creating a user experience that is minimally intrusive. It operates with its own package manager, apk, and employs the OpenRC init system along with script-driven configurations. This methodology results in a clear and uncomplicated Linux environment, devoid of unnecessary complexities, making it a popular option for those who appreciate efficiency and clarity in their operating system. Moreover, the emphasis on simplicity enables users to focus on their work without being sidetracked by superfluous features or components, ultimately fostering greater productivity.
